Epsom Salt for Plants Ideas
DIY Gardening

10 Epsom Salt for Plants Ideas

By admin

Epsom salt is often used by gardeners as a simple magnesium boost for some plants. It can be helpful when soil is low in magnesium, but it should not be used as a cure for every plant problem. These ideas show practical ways to style and use Epsom salt carefully around potted plants, flowers, vegetables, and houseplants.

Epsom Salt for Potted Plants

Epsom Salt for Potted Plants

Epsom salt can be used carefully for some potted plants if they show signs of magnesium shortage. Mix a small amount with water instead of sprinkling too much on the soil. Use it as an occasional boost, not a regular fertilizer. Keep potted plants well-drained so roots stay healthy.

Epsom Salt Watering Mix

Epsom Salt Watering Mix

An Epsom salt watering mix is one of the easiest ways to apply it evenly. Dissolve a small amount in water before using it around the base of plants. This helps prevent clumps in the soil. Use it only once in a while, and do not replace normal plant food with it.

Epsom Salt for Tomato Plants

Epsom Salt for Tomato Plants

Tomato plants are often mentioned with Epsom salt, but they only benefit if magnesium is actually low. Use a light watering mix around the soil, not directly on leaves in hot sun. Keep tomatoes supported, watered evenly, and mulched. Healthy soil will do more for tomatoes than extra additives.

Epsom Salt for Pepper Plants

Epsom Salt for Pepper Plants

Pepper plants may respond well to magnesium when the soil needs it. A mild Epsom salt solution can be used around the base during active growth. Avoid using too much because extra salt can build up in containers. Pair this with steady watering and a sunny spot for better plant health.

Epsom Salt for Roses

Epsom Salt for Roses

Some gardeners use Epsom salt for roses to support green leaves and strong growth. Use it lightly around established rose bushes and water it in well. Do not pile it near the stems. Roses still need good pruning, mulch, sunlight, and balanced fertilizer to bloom well throughout the season.

Epsom Salt for Houseplants

Epsom Salt for Houseplants

Houseplants should be treated gently with Epsom salt. Use a very diluted mix only if the plant may need magnesium. Many indoor plant issues come from overwatering, low light, or poor drainage instead. Check the plant’s basic care needs first before adding anything extra to the soil.

Epsom Salt Soil Boost

Epsom Salt Soil Boost

Epsom salt can work as a small soil boost when magnesium is missing, but it should not be used blindly. A soil test is the best way to know what your garden needs. If you use it, measure carefully and water it in. Too much can upset the soil balance.

Conclusion

Epsom salt can be useful for plants when magnesium is low, but it is not a magic fix for every garden problem. Use it lightly, measure carefully, and focus first on soil quality, sunlight, drainage, and watering. A simple, balanced routine will keep plants healthier than adding too much of anything.

FAQs

1. Is Epsom salt good for all plants?

No. It is only useful when plants need magnesium. Some plants may not need it at all.

2. Can I sprinkle Epsom salt directly on soil?

You can, but dissolving it in water is often easier and safer for even application.

3. How often should I use Epsom salt on plants?

Use it only occasionally and lightly. Too much can build up and affect soil balance.

4. Does Epsom salt replace fertilizer?

No. Epsom salt provides magnesium and sulfur, but it does not replace a balanced fertilizer.
